Madam President, today America grieves. There is nothing partisan about being a parent and grandparent. I cannot imagine--I cannot imagine--the grief felt by the parents of those children. Unless you have experienced it, none of us can. What is the solution? There is no one solution. Let's be honest about that. Following Sandy Hook, following Parkland, I met with the parents of those horrific and senseless tragedies. I have been blessed to get to know three parents quite well: Tom and Gina Hoyer, and Max Schachter. Tom and Gina are the parents of Luke Hoyer; Max is the father of Alex Schachter--two of the 17 victims of the Marjory Stoneman Douglas High School slaughter in Parkland, FL, that occurred on February 14, 2018. In getting to know Tom and Gina and Max, you get some sense of the level of grief. I mentioned there is nothing partisan about grief. I listened to President Biden's remarks last night, I think the point he made that pierced my heart, because President Biden has known tragedy, is when he said that those parents in Texas, they are asking themselves will they ever sleep again. So we all grieve. We are all looking for solutions. The good Senator from Delaware said: ``We must take action.'' So what I have always valued about Tom and Gina and Max is these are three individuals, parents who do know the pain, that still grieve the loss of their sons, and yet they have not approached trying to find solutions in any partisan way whatsoever.…
